Christian Hilfgott Brand - Wooded Landscape with a Sitting Shepherd
The landscape features a resting shepherd in a forest interior. The composition and manner of execution suggest an inspiration in the work of Johann Heinrich Roos and corroborate Brand’s willingness to seek inspiration in paintings of other artists. However, an effort to transpose reality onto the canvas with the utmost faithfulness is already discernible in his works. The painting signed „Brand Senior“ attests to its later production in the 1750s when Brand’s son Johann Christian Brand (1722-1795) was already active as an artist. At the time, Brand Senior taught at the Vienna Academy. The painting is one piece from the numerous group of works by Brand the father, originally in the collection of Josef Hoser.
